If you don't want to buy normal Rider Backs , you should buy Bicycle Seconds.U should go to golden landmark and there is a shop that sells alot of cards.It is $3.50 and do NOT go to the Magic Hall to get them because they are sold there for $8(rip off , scam).Bicycle Seconds are basically cards that did not qualify to go into normal Rider Backs so don't be surprised if they are off centered or if their ink are smudged.
